Art. 921.1. Notice of decision in criminal appeals

A. In addition to the requirements regarding transmission of notice of judgment and copies of decisions under the Uniform Rules of Louisiana Courts of Appeal, when a decision in an appellate court in a criminal appeal is rendered, the clerk of court shall transmit a notice or copy of the decision to the clerk of court from which the appeal was taken and to the Department of Public Safety and Corrections.

B. When a decision of the supreme court is rendered in a criminal appeal, the clerk of court shall transmit a notice or copy of the decision to the clerk of court from which the appeal was taken and to the Department of Public Safety and Corrections.

Acts 2014, No. 600, §1.
